Network Split Uncertainty

Risk

Network Split Uncertainty represents the probabilistic exposure to financial loss stemming from the potential divergence of a blockchain’s consensus mechanism, leading to the creation of competing chains. This uncertainty directly impacts derivative valuations, particularly options, as the underlying asset’s price can experience significant volatility during and after a split. Quantifying this risk necessitates modeling the probability of a split, the resulting asset allocation between chains, and the correlated price impact on associated financial instruments.
